what is the closed loop precision that you can achieve with these motors
golllub 7 months ago
@golllub The closed loop precision depends on the resolution of the encoder used. Our standard resolution encoder is 1-micron, but it can be as large as 5-micron or as small as 50nm. The resolution chosen depends on the requirements of your application.
